C430C222J1G5TA7200 by KEMET Corporation

KEMET C430C222J1G5TA7200 is a ceramic capacitor with 0.0022uF capacitance and 100V rated DC voltage. With C0G temperature characteristics, it operates b/w -55 to 125 °C, ideal for applications requiring high precision and stability in harsh environments. Featuring axial package style, matte tin finish, and through-hole mounting, it suits various electronic circuits.

Feature Benefit Bullets

Dielectric Material: CERAMIC

Ceramic is a reliable dielectric material known for its stability and high insulation resistance, making this capacitor a dependable choice for various applications.

Multi-layer: Yes

Multi-layer construction allows for higher capacitance in a smaller package, making this capacitor space-efficient while offering the desired capacitance value.

No. of Terminals: 2

Having 2 terminals simplifies the connection process and enhances the overall reliability of the capacitor in the circuit.

Terminal Shape: WIRE

Wire terminals provide a secure and stable connection, ensuring good electrical contact and ease of installation in various electronic devices.

Temperature Characteristics Code: C0G

C0G temperature characteristics indicate a capacitor with low capacitance change over temperature, making it suitable for demanding applications where stable capacitance is required.

Manufacturer Highlights

KEMET Corporation

KEMET Corporation is an American electronics company that specializes in the design, manufacturing, and distribution of capacitors, electromagnetic compatibility solutions, and other electronic components. The company was founded in 1919 and is headquartered in Fort Lauderdale, Florida, with manufacturing facilities and sales offices around the world. KEMET Corporation and its subsidiaries (KEMET), is a wholly owned subsidiary of Yageo Corporation (TAIEX: 2327).
